The Diagnostic Medical Sonographer certification program at Delaware Technical Community College's Georgetown Campus is designed to prepare students for entry-level careers in medical sonography. The program covers ultrasound technology, anatomy and physiology, patient care, and sonographic techniques/procedures. Graduates of this program are eligible to take the American Registry for Diagnostic Medical Sonography (ARDMS) exam and become certified sonographers.

Delaware Technical Community College (Workforce Development) - Georgetown Campus

Delaware Technical Community College's Jack F. Owens Campus is located at 21179 College Dr, Georgetown, DE 19947. This campus offers a broad spectrum of academic and vocational programs, including the HLH 130 Nurse Assistant Training program, which focuses on preparing students to become certified nursing assistants by emphasizing critical skills such as communication, observation, and documentation. The 147-acre campus provides an integrated learning experience with both academic and practical components, featuring modern facilities tailored to the diverse needs of its students.
